Product Overview
Hastelloy C22 Seamless Nickel Alloy Tube ASTM B622 Seamless Round Tube
Alloy C-22 is an enhanced nickel-chromium-molybdenum-tungsten alloy designed for superior performance in aggressive industrial environments. This alloy demonstrates exceptional resistance to pitting, crevice corrosion, and chloride stress corrosion cracking, making it ideal for demanding applications.
Key Advantages
  • Superior overall corrosion resistance compared to Alloy C-276
  • Outstanding resistance to chloride pitting, crevice corrosion, and stress corrosion cracking
  • Excellent performance in oxidizing aqueous environments including wet chlorine and nitric acid/chloride mixtures
Chemical Composition
Hastelloy C22, UNS N06220
Element Ni Cr Mo Mn Si C S P Cu V W Fe
MIN Balance 20.0 12.5 -- -- -- -- -- -- -- 2.5 --
MAX Balance 22.5 14.5 0.5 0.08 0.015 0.02 0.02 2.5 0.35 3.5 6.0
Mechanical Properties
Temperature (°F) 70 200 400 600 800 1000 1200 1400
Ultimate Tensile Strength (ksi) 114 107 98 95 92 88 83 76
0.2% Yield Strength (ksi) 54 49 41 36 35 34 32 31
Elongation (%) 62 65 66 68 68 67 69 68
Hardness MAX (HRB) 95 -- -- -- -- -- -- --
Fabrication Guidelines
While ductile enough for cold working, intermediate annealing may be required due to work hardening. Forging should occur between 1750-2050°F followed by rapid cooling. Annealing is recommended at 2020-2150°F with rapid quenching to prevent formation of detrimental phases between 1400-1800°F. Welding can be performed using gas tungsten-arc, gas metal-arc, and shielded metal-arc processes.
Industry Standards
Hastelloy C22, UNS N06220 ASTM Specifications
Product Form Standard
Pipe Seamless B622
Pipe Welded B619
Tube Seamless B622
Tube Welded B626
Sheet/Plate B575
Bar B574
Forging B564
Fitting B366
Applications
  • Pharmaceutical industries for corrosion-resistant fittings and tubing
  • Cellophane manufacturing processes
  • Chlorination systems
  • Pesticide production equipment
  • Incineration scrubber systems
  • Chemical process industry including flue gas scrubbers, sulfur dioxide scrubbers, pulp and paper bleach plants, pickling systems, and nuclear fuel reprocessing
  • Waste water processing systems
